Just out of curiosity I wanted find out what my frame rates were like while in external camera mode in port and out at sea. I'm running the GWX mod and I have found while in port with all the activity going on I'm running about 18 to 24 FPS, but when I venture out to sea I'm running pretty much double that at 42 to 48 FPS. The interior areas run about 10 FPS more than previously specified.
From a hardware poiunt of view what components help boost the FPS figure? Is it a combination of RAM, Mobo, CPU or Graphics Card? Or is it a particular compenent such as the GPU? Current Spec AMD 64 3500+ 2.1Ghz Corsair TwinX 1 pair of 512Mb modules (1Gb Total) Asus A8N SLI Deluxe Asus EN7900GT TOP Graphics Card |
